Pitambarpur Village

Pitambarpur is an inhabited village in Simri Block of Buxar district, Bihar. Its Census village code is 247917, the Census 2011 record lists 110 people in 13 households and the reported area is 25.19 hectares. The local references include Kazipur Gram Panchayat, Simri CD Block and the nearest town reference is Dumraon at about 5 km.

Land Use and Local Economy

Land-use records for Pitambarpur show that reported agricultural commodities include Paddy, net sown area is 8.99 hectares and irrigated land is 8.99 hectares (100% of net sown area). These figures help explain village agriculture and local economy context.
